Holistic Remedies for Dog Coat Sensitivities
Dealing with your beloved friend’s epidermal allergies can be truly distressing. While a visit to the animal doctor is crucial for identification , exploring safe remedies can often provide much-needed relief . Many owners are seeking natural options to help their canine's irritated skin. Here are a few possibilities to consider. Always check with your veterinarian before starting any alternative treatments.
- ACV : Combined in a solution , this can help inflammation.
- Virgin Coconut: Applied topically, it’s recognized for its hydrating properties.
- Oatmeal Baths : Colloidal oatmeal can reduce scratching .
- Gut Health Supplements : Supporting digestive wellness may lessen allergic reactions .
Remember, finding the root cause of the allergy is essential to long-term wellness . Attentive observation and regular work are key to enhancing your canine's total health .

Top Ways to Give Skin Relief with Your Pup
Dealing with Fido's allergies can be frustrating . Fortunately, there are a number of approaches to lessen your furry friend's discomfort. First, investigate a nutritional change, trying a hypoallergenic food . Secondly, regular baths with a soothing cleanser can remove allergens from her skin . Thirdly, ensure a clean living , vacuuming frequently to eliminate dust mites and pollen . Fourthly, talk your veterinarian about medicated treatments or additives. Finally, manage fleas as these can aggravate existing skin conditions – providing preventative products is key.
